X-ray Focusing Lenses
- Change the divergence of the 1 micron KB beam and control the spot size in SC1
- PACK2
- Smaller focus for running experiment (X-ray probe)
- 20-30 um at IP
- PACK3
- Bigger focus for IP or TT timing (X-ray pump)
- 200-300 um
- OUT position: Y = -8 mm
NOTE: every time we change the focusing configuration, we need to record the change and sign in the CXI logbook hard copy.
Intensity-Position Monitor (IPM)
- Non-destructive relative measurement of the pulse intensity using Wave8
- It can measure both the intensity and position, however, the position measurement is complex and we generally only use it as intensity monitor, and use it as X-ray pulse energy normalization in many diagnostics (X-ray I0)
- In DAQ, it is the detector: CXI-DG2-BMONN

Profile-Intensity Monitor (PIM)
- Measure the beam profile on the way to the 1 micron focus, after the 100 nm focus or after the refocusing DG2 lenses
- CXI DG2 YAG
- With the prefocus lens, we have ~200 um on DG2 YAG
- With the prefocus lens and the DG2 lens, they together make the focus ~20-30 um at IP
- IOC camera: cxi_dg2_yag
